Elon Musk needs little introduction. His acumen has transformed the business of electric vehicles and getting to space, and he has more recently been at the right hand of US President Donald Trump. The entrepreneur’s influence is everywhere, but his iconoclasm has also made him a magnet for controversy. Tesla has experienced a pronounced backlash – you might have seen the stickers: “I bought this before we knew Elon was crazy” – and Bill Gates recently accused Musk of being responsible for killing children by pushing massive cuts to US foreign aid. To get Musk’s reactions to as many of these points as possible, Bloomberg Weekend Editor-at-Large Mishal Husain sat down (virtually) with him at the Qatar Economic Forum on May 20.
